You can buy low hour cameras (15 or less) for 2K or under and Final Cut pro now natively supports Canon Raw Light. Now modern computers have no issue handling these RAW light files. C200 has to be the best for the buck Cinema camera you can get. Oh and 256gb Sandisk Cfast 2.0 cards can be had for 140 dollars used. With a small budget you can have a complete turnkey cinema setup for creating an independent film on a shoestring budget.
